Web using wire, both aluminum and copper, for bonsai art design is a relatively recent practice, dating from the 20th century. The lower the gauge number, the thicker the diameter of the wire. Web bonsai wiring is primarily done using anodized aluminum or copper wire, with aluminum being the most widely used choice for various tree types.
